Ebo, Angola

Population: 165,129

Ebo, a lesser-known gem in Angola, captivates with its unique blend of geological and historical features. Enveloped by the lush landscapes of the Angolan highlands, it is distinguished by the nearby unique karst formations and ancient rock art, remnants of early indigenous cultures that provide a glimpse into Africa's prehistoric era. Ebo's vibrant local markets stand out for their trade in traditional Kimbundu crafts, reflecting the rich heritage of the Mbundu people who infuse their storytelling artistry into woven baskets and pottery.
